Apparently the women's toilet has some offensive graffiti in it as of last night. I haven't seen it but it apparently says something like "I'm a sexy young boy looking for MILFs to f**k, call this number".
So of course any female customers who used that toilet complained about it. After the first complaint, my female co-worker had a look then called the local graffiti removal service. From the second complaint onwards we told people that we are aware of it and are waiting for the graffiti removal people to arrive and clean it (or more likely, paint over it). It's a free service provided by the local council and because it's run by volunteers who don't get paid, it's not exactly rapid response.
Then the police arrived.
Apparently one SC had anonymously called the police and told them we're "displaying offensive pornography".
Once they saw the graffiti and heard what we're doing about it, they decided that there were no real grounds for police involvement. They agreed yes it's offensive but no it's not pornographic and waiting for the volunteer graffiti removal squad is a good enough response. In the meantime, keep on apologising and letting people know it is being dealt with.
